DEVELOPMENTAL EDUCATION

This 11 or 12-credit combined course prepares English-as-a-Second-Language students for credit courses by building reading comprehension, vocabulary, grammar and writing skills. Students participate in writing work which coordinates with reading, speaking and listening activities. Plan to spend one hour in the Reading Lab during the first week of the quarter for orientation.
